idragosani wrote:Are there minimum system requirements?
Android 2.3.3, ARM or X86 CPU, 512MB of RAM and 150MB available in the flash drive.

TVP on android is the best that could happen with my thinkpad tablet. Let me stop praising, although it is hard to resist.
Instead, let me make some comments. I have found no thread for beta feedback so I decided to post my comments here, hopefully you can use them to improve the final product:
major:
- pen-only mode on thinkpad ics not working with tvp - i.e. for some reason tvp even in this mode registers touch events
- when pen button held, it should work as the eraser button works on the pc+wacom version of tvp
minor:
- top menu should be collapsible to preserve space
- bottom info bar also should be optional to preserve space
- smoothing option for the pens seems to be missing
- a small toolbar optimized for drawing on touchscreens would come handy, including minimally undo/redo and prev/next/add frame icons
- at startup the screen view option should be restored too - i use 'fit' usually, and now at each startup i have to press it again
(overall, with the pen, the interface is surprisingly usable even on such a limited screen size)
